Namibia Poverty and Equity Brief : April 2025 (anglais)

Namibia experienced significant welfare improvements between 2003/04 and 2015/16, with national official poverty declining by more than half from 37.5 to 17.4 percent. However, falling commodity prices, weak trade growth, and weak demand, exacerbated by the COVID-19 pandemic, led to negative real GDP per capita growth between 2016 and 2020.
